DocumentCode :
2975131
Title :
An adaptive learning approach to software cost estimation
Author :
Kaushik, Akhil ; Soni, A.K. ; Soni, R.
Author_Institution :
Dept. of IT, Maharaja Surajmal Inst. of Tech., Delhi, India
fYear :
2012
fDate :
21-22 Nov. 2012
Firstpage :
1
Lastpage :
6
Abstract :
Software cost estimation predicts the amount of effort and development time required to build a software system. It is one of the most critical tasks and it helps the software industries to effectively manage their software development process. There are a number of cost estimation models. The most widely used model is Constructive Cost Model (COCOMO). In this paper, the use of back propagation neural networks for software cost estimation is proposed. The model is designed in such a manner that accommodates the COCOMO model and improves its performance. It also enhances the predictability of the software cost estimates. The model is tested using two datasets COCOMO dataset and COCOMO NASA 2 dataset. The test results from the trained neural network are compared with that of the COCOMO model. From the experimental results, it was concluded that the integration of the conventional COCOMO model and the neural network approach improves the cost estimation accuracy and the estimated cost can be very close to the actual cost.
Keywords :
DP industry; backpropagation; neural nets; software cost estimation; software management; software performance evaluation; COCOMO NASA 2 dataset; COCOMO model; adaptive learning approach; backpropagation neural network training; constructive cost model; cost estimation accuracy improvement; performance improvement; software cost estimation predictability enhancement; software development process management; software development time prediction; software effort estimation; software industries; software system; Computational modeling; Computer architecture; Estimation; Mathematical model; Neural networks; Software; Training; Artificial Neural Networks; Backpropagation Networks; COCOMO model; Project management; Soft Computing Techniques; Software Effort Estimation;
fLanguage :
English
Publisher :
ieee
Conference_Titel :
Computing and Communication Systems (NCCCS), 2012 National Conference on
Conference_Location :
Durgapur
Print_ISBN :
978-1-4673-1952-2
Type :
conf
DOI :
10.1109/NCCCS.2012.6413029
Filename :
6413029
Link To Document :
بازگشت